Dr. Raksha Thakur holds a Doctorate in International Business from the SOE, D.A.V.V., Indore, with her research focused on “the impact of price dumping on the Indian economy”

Dr. Thakur boasts over 17 years of academic experience, having taught at both the postgraduate and undergraduate levels. She is recognized as a Ph.D. supervisor at D.A.V.V., Indore, and her credentials extend beyond the academic realm. Dr. Thakur is an alumni of IIM Indore for pursuing an MDP on International Marketing. She demonstrated exceptional dedication and aptitude in the NPTEL certification course ‘Global Marketing Management,’ conducted by IIT Roorkee. She earned the distinction of being the course topper and received the prestigious ‘Elite’ category of certification.  

Her extensive scholarly contributions include more than 25 publications in reputed journals. Dr. Thakur has been recognized for her research, having been awarded a few best paper awards, one of them by JBIMS, Mumbai University.

In addition to her academic pursuits, she is a lifetime member of the Madhya Pradesh Economic Association (MPEA) and holds White and Yellow Belts in Six Sigma Quality Management Certification. Dr. Thakur’s academic endeavours have taken her across 13 countries. Her leadership extends to being the editor of the book ‘Research Foresight.’
